What a universal files converter does
- Format translation: Converts between document, image, audio and video formats (e.g., PDF ↔ DOCX, PNG → JPG, AVI → MP4).
- Batch processing: Converts many files at once to save time.
- Quality control: Lets you set resolution, bitrate or compression levels to balance size and fidelity.
- OCR (optical character recognition): Extracts editable text from scanned images or PDFs.
- Metadata and layout preservation: Keeps document structure, fonts, and metadata where possible.
- Security options: Adds password protection or removes sensitive metadata.
Common conversion scenarios
- PDF to DOCX (editable document): Useful when you need to revise content from a static PDF. A good converter preserves layout and applies OCR to scanned pages.
- DOCX to PDF (shareable, fixed layout): Converts resumes, reports, or forms into a format that looks the same across devices.
- Image conversions (PNG, JPG, WebP): Convert high-quality PNGs to smaller JPGs for web use, or to WebP for modern browsers. Adjust quality to reduce file size.
- Video conversions (AVI, MKV → MP4): Convert legacy or high-bitrate files to MP4 with H.264/H.265 for compatibility and smaller sizes. Choose a balance between bitrate and resolution.
- Batch resizing and format change: Resize and convert dozens of images for a website in one operation.
- Audio extraction: Pull MP3 audio from MP4 video for podcasts or transcription.
How to use a files converter effectively
- Choose the right target format: Pick formats matched to your goal (editability: DOCX; cross-platform sharing: PDF; web images: JPG/WebP; universal video: MP4).
- Check settings before converting: Set DPI for images, enable OCR for scanned PDFs, and choose codec/bitrate for video.
- Use batch mode for multiple files: Prepare files in a folder and run a single batch job to save time.
- Preview results: Convert a single sample first to verify layout, quality, and file size.
- Keep originals: Always keep a copy of the original file until you confirm the converted version is acceptable.
- Automate recurring tasks: Use presets or command-line tools for repeated workflows (e.g., nightly conversions or bulk resizing).
Choosing the right converter — features to prioritize
- Supported formats: Broad coverage across documents, images, audio, and video.
- OCR accuracy: Critical for editable text extraction from scanned documents.
- Batch & automation: Essential for productivity with many files.
- Speed and resource use: Faster conversions and lower CPU demands matter for large jobs.
- Output quality controls: Adjustable resolution, bitrate, and compression settings.
- Security & privacy: Look for tools that do not upload files to third parties if you handle sensitive content.
- User interface & integrations: Drag-and-drop, cloud storage connectors (Google Drive, Dropbox) and API access for developers.
- Platform availability: Web-based, desktop (Windows/Mac/Linux), and mobile options depending on your needs.
Tips for best results
- For scanned PDFs, enable OCR and choose the correct language for higher text-recognition accuracy.
- When converting images for the web, aim for 70–85% JPEG quality to balance clarity and size.
- For videos, use H.264 with a moderate bitrate for broad compatibility; use H.265 for better compression if target devices support it.
- Test file compatibility with the target app (e.g., import a converted DOCX into Google Docs and Microsoft Word).
- If privacy is a concern, use local desktop software or a trusted offline tool rather than an online service.
Quick glossary
- OCR: Optical character recognition to convert images of text into machine-readable text.
- Codec: Algorithm used to compress/decompress audio or video (e.g., H.264, H.265).
- Bitrate: Amount of data processed per second in audio/video — higher gives better quality and larger files.
- DPI: Dots per inch, image resolution measure useful for printing quality.
